Though fans are mainly split into two separate camps over this issue, there are a growing number of impartial FIFA players going into FIFA 15 who are clamouring for a changing of the guard regarding who the best player on the game is statistically. For every FIFA instalment in recent memory, Barcelonas Lionel Messi has deservedly been rated as being the best footballer on the planet. However, this year the little Argentine has been uncharacteristically quiet. He has still done more than enough to make a case that he should still be considered the greatest but there many fans who believe that based on their respective 2013/14 performances, Cristiano Ronaldo should be on top. Not only did Real Madrids superstar score more goals but he also received the much-coveted Ballon dOr over the likes of Messi and Ribery. We understand that Messi is in cahoots with EA to help them market their FIFA franchise so it shouldnt come as a surprise that they are inclined to favour Barcelonas player. Though it is as yet unconfirmed what the player ratings will be for FIFA 15, the trailer released at E3 makes it abundantly clear that it will again be Lionel. The Argentine is shown in the demos final segment of action scoring a thunderous goal over the head of Atletico Madrids Thibaut Courtois while Ronaldo doesnt even feature in the trailer. Moreover, the fact that customers who pre-order FIFA 15 will have access to a Messi on loan for the first part of their Ultimate Team campaign corroborates the theory that Messi will once again be top dog, despite many fans believing that Ronaldo has done enough to at least be ranked as his rivals equal.
